+/*!
+ * \brief Returns if one context includes another context
+ *
+ * \param parent Parent context to search for child
+ * \param child Context to check for inclusion in parent
+ *
+ * This function recrusively checks if the context child is included in the context parent.
+ *
+ * \return 1 if child is included in parent, 0 if not
+ */
+static int context_included(const char *parent, const char *child);
+static int context_included(const char *parent, const char *child)
+{
+ struct ast_context *c = NULL;
+
+ c = ast_context_find(parent);
+ if (!c) {
+ /* well, if parent doesn't exist, how can the child be included in it? */
+ return 0;
+ }
+ if (!strcmp(ast_get_context_name(c), parent)) {
+ /* found the context of the hint app_queue is using. Now, see
+ if that context includes the one that just changed state */
+ struct ast_include *inc = NULL;
+
+ while ((inc = (struct ast_include*) ast_walk_context_includes(c, inc))) {
+ const char *includename = ast_get_include_name(inc);
+ if (!strcasecmp(child, includename)) {
+ return 1;
+ }
+ /* recurse on this context, for nested includes. The
+ PBX extension parser will prevent infinite recursion. */
+ if (context_included(includename, child)) {
+ return 1;
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 return 0;
+}
